Charting was introduced to Slicer 4 in February of 2012

Introduction

Chart colors will be either derived from the generic LUT below, or, where appropriate, will be taken from the LUT used for the input data.

Notes

2010 Generic Anatomy Colors for use with the Slicer3 Editor Module as a default color table for editing medical image data with no prior knowledge of the condition, modality, or specific anatomical region being displayed. When additional protocol knowledge is available (i.e. angiography of the brain) a different color table with more specific labels may be chosen.

Authors: Michael Halle, Florin Talos, Ron Kikinis, Steve Pieper, Nicole Aucoin.


Lookup table

This color table uses approximately equal steps in hue to define a color pallet that allows each color to be distinguish and visually pleasing. Based on the papers by Maureen Stone "Expert Color Choices for Presenting Data" and "Choosing Colors for Data Visualization".
